The new Bing Wallpaper app released by Microsoft for Windows 11/10 brings some of the world’s finest surroundings right to your Desktop. If you like Bing.com’s background images and download ...
Microsoft has rolled out exciting updates to its Bing Image Creator, making it faster, easier to use, and more accessible than ever. Originally launched in 2023, Bing Image Creator is an AI ...